Skip to content
Check Run Reporter

Check Run Reporter

See your test and style results without leaving GitHub. Works with any CI service. Supports JUnit, Checkstyle, and more

by check-run-reporter902 installs

About

GitHub has verified that the publisher controls the domain and meets other requirements.

Supported languages

JavaScript, Ruby, Python, PHP, Objective-C, Java, Go, TypeScript, and Swift

Check Run Reporter takes your JUnit, Checkstyle, and other structured reports and presents their results to you right in the GitHub UI. No more need to dig through your pages of CI logs to find out why your build failed.

Test Results

All of your test results will appear right in the Pull Request's details view. If the line that failed can be determined from the test report, you'll also see the error in the diff. If your test suite can produce JUnit, it works with Check Run Reporter.

Style Violations

Style violations will be presented right in the pull request diff, so you'll be able to see exactly what went wrong next to the style rule that didn't hold. Check Run Reporter supports the native report formats of ESlint, SwiftLint and the TypeScript compiler and we recently added support for Checkstyle, opening up most every style-checker out there.

If you have a test or style report format that we don't support, reach out and we'll look into adding it.

Check Run Reporter screenshot

Pricing and setup

Unlimited public repositories

$0

See your CI failures without leaving GitHub

$19/ month

Ephemeral

See your CI failures without leaving GitHub

  • Unlimited public repositories
  • Unlimited private repositories
  • 50000 submissions/month
  • 1GB of submissions/month

Check Run Reporter is provided by a third-party and is governed by separate terms of service, privacy policy, and support documentation